L3Harris Technologies is an agile global aerospace and defense technology innovator, delivering end-to-end solutions that meet customers’ mission-critical needs. The company provides advanced defense and commercial technologies across space, air, land, sea and cyber domains. L3Harris has approximately $18 billion in annual revenue and 50,000 employees, with customers in more than 100 countries.

L3Harris’ Communication Systems segment is currently seeking a Lead, Information Security Systems Engineer to join our team. This position will be based at our Salt Lake City-UT facility.
Position Overview:
As a Lead, Information Security Systems Engineer at L3Harris Technologies, you will be involved in the cryptography that enables communication capabilities for the warfighter. We are looking for people with experience with cryptography design, development, and certification via FIPS 140 and/or NSA certification processes. Our team includes both experienced and developing engineers in the field of cryptography. We hope to find candidates who are ready to work on a deeply technical, high energy team.
Essential Responsibilities:
- Understand and apply NSA and FIPS 140 requirements to cryptography products
- Work with both software and hardware design engineers to implement requirements that satisfy the certification standards
- Produce design and testing documentation to validate the implementation of the requirements
- Lead NSA certification and FIPS 140 validation development efforts
- Interface with internal and external customers to discuss design, implementation, and certification progress
- Able to adapt to change, focus on timeliness, and collaborate in joint decision-making processes is essential
- Ask questions and seek clarification on unfamiliar and/or unclear concepts, designs, and implementation details
- Travel up to 25% as needed
